Transaction 7733faadc343b4610bfd99b107cba47f5a625044c5687060a26f9953678bf787
1 Input
2 Outputs
- 7733faadc343b4610bfd99b107cba47f5a625044c5687060a26f9953678bf787:0
- 7733faadc343b4610bfd99b107cba47f5a625044c5687060a26f9953678bf787:1
value 649403
address 1CxoT97eNGMvLGRYosCTCp3Zi14wBQyU2y
value 675990
address 1Lp8xu1fkpBPLJ3vHnw3QB3kAkDtmyDwUT